2017-04-12 107 views

回答

0

這基本上是一個CORS問題,而不是從API問題,因爲您試圖從不同的來源進行訪問。

你有一個很好的答案over here coupple可以從一個特定的來源或任何來源,因爲你可以指定一個單一的來源或任何來源的訪問。

+0

問題是一樣的沒有發生它 –

+0

謝謝,這段代碼工作和我的問題解決了 –

0

嘗試在WordPress htaccess文件添加代碼

<IfModule mod_headers.c> 
    Header set Access-Control-Allow-Origin "*" 
</IfModule> 

,並添加下列行動在WordPress

/** 
* Use * for origin 
*/ 
add_action('rest_api_init', function() { 

    remove_filter('rest_pre_serve_request', 'rest_send_cors_headers'); 
    add_filter('rest_pre_serve_request', function($value) { 
     header('Access-Control-Allow-Origin: *'); 
     header('Access-Control-Allow-Methods: POST, GET, OPTIONS, PUT, DELETE'); 
     header('Access-Control-Allow-Credentials: true'); 

     return $value; 

    }); 
}, 15); 

或簡單地添加以下中的wp-content /插件/ JSON-API /單身/ api.php

<? header("Access-Control-Allow-Origin: *"); ?>